Ingredients
Scale
- 2 medium-sized bo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into uniform 1-inch pieces
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- Garlic powder
- Onion powder
- Italian seasoning
- 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ese, divided
- Salt & black pepper, to taste
- 12 ounces rotini pasta
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 3–4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 1 cup low-sodium ch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 2 tablespoons cream cheese (optional)
- F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ish
Instructions
- Step 1: Prepare and Cook the Garlic Parmesan Chicken Bites
- Cut the Chicken: Start by patting your boneless, skinless chicken breasts dry with paper towels. Then, cut them into approximately 1-inch bite-sized pieces.
- Season the Chicken: In a medium bowl, toss the chicken pieces with 1 tablespoon of ol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, Italian seasoning, about half of the grated Parmesan cheese, and a good pinch of salt and black pepper.
- Sear the Chicken: Heat the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ken bites in a single layer and cook for 3-5 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.
- Step 2: Cook the Rotini Pasta
- Boil the Water: Bring a large pot of generously salted water to a rolling boil.
- Cook the Pasta: Add the rotini pasta to the boiling water and cook according to package directions until al dente.
- Drain and Reserve: Before draining, scoop out about 1 cup of the starchy pasta water. Drain the rest of the pasta and set aside.
- Step 3: Craft the Creamy Rotini Sauce
- Sauté the Garlic: In the same skillet, melt the unsalted butter over medium heat. Add the minced fresh garlic and cook for about 1 minute until fragrant.
- Build the Sauce Base: Pour in the chicken broth, stirring to scrape up any browned bits from the bottom of the pan. Bring it to a gentle simmer.
- Add Cream and Cheese: Reduce the heat to low and stir in the heavy cream and the remaining grated Parmesan cheese. If using cream cheese, add it now and stir until melted.
- Simmer and Season: Let the sauce gently simmer for 3-5 minutes until it slightly thickens.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
- Step 4: Combine and Serve
- Combine Pasta and Sauce: Add the cooked and drained rotini pasta directly into the skillet with the creamy sauce. Toss gently to coat.
- Add Chicken Bites: Return the cooked garlic Parmesan chicken bites to the skillet and gently toss to combine.
- Garnish and Serve: Divide the dish among serving plates, garnish with fresh chopped parsley and extra grated Parmesan cheese. Serve immediately.

Keywords: For best results, cut chicken into uniform pieces for even cooking. Don't overcrowd the pan when searing the chicken. Use reserved pasta water to adjust sauce consistency. Fresh garlic is recommended for the sauce for a more vibrant flavor. Quality Parmesan makes a difference in taste.
